Hi all,
I'm having problems using a combobox to display text at a bookmark in Word 2007 and would be grateful for any clues ![]() The code I have so far allows the user to select from the combobox and have the selected item text appear within a string at a bookmark when I run the code. But I would like the user to be able to enter any word into the combobox and have that entry appear within the bookmark. Example: I have a combobox with the options Red, Green and Blue. If pick one of these, the selected one appears at the bookmark, however I don't know what to do if they should manually type another colour, say orange, into the combobox. Any Ideas ? Here is the code so far: Code:
Sub testCombobox() Dim objCC As ContentControl Dim objLE As ContentControlListEntry Dim isel As String Set objCC = ActiveDocument.ContentControls(1) For i = 1 To objCC.DropdownListEntries.Count If objCC.DropdownListEntries.Item(i).Text = objCC.Range.Text Then Set objLE = objCC.DropdownListEntries.Item(i) If objLE.Text = "Red" Then isel = " red" ElseIf objLE.Text = "Green" Then isel = " green" ElseIf objLE.Text = "Blue" Then isel = "blue" End If End If Next i ActiveDocument.Bookmarks("picked").Range.InsertAfter "You picked " & isel End Sub Regards, Dan Last edited by macropod; 03-18-2014 at 04:35 PM.
